.pointrouge {
  grid-area: pointrouge;
  display: flex;
  column-gap: var(--spc_1);
	align-self: flex-start;
}

@media screen and (min-width: 576px) {
	#product .pointrouge img {
		width: 98px;
		height: 16px;
	}
}
